Chicken Pho

Ingredients

  • 2 lb bone-in chicken pieces
  • 8 oz flat rice noodles
  • 1 onion
  • 3 inch piece ginger
  • 3 star anise
  • 1 cinnamon stick
  • 3 whole cloves
  • 1 tbsp coriander seeds
  • 3 tbsp fish sauce
  • 8 cups water
  • 2 cups bean sprouts
  • 1 cup Thai basil
  • 2 limes
  • 2 jalapenos
  • 1/2 cup cilantro
  • 1 tsp salt

How to cook it

  1. Char the onion and ginger under the broiler or in a dry pan until blackened in spots, about 5 minutes.
  2. Toast the star anise, cinnamon, cloves, and coriander in a dry pot until fragrant, 1 minute.
  3. Add the chicken, charred onion and ginger, fish sauce, salt, and water, and simmer gently for 45 minutes.
  4. Remove the chicken, shred the meat, and strain the broth.
  5. Soak the rice noodles in hot water until tender, then divide among bowls with the shredded chicken.
  6. Ladle the hot broth over the top and serve with bean sprouts, Thai basil, lime, jalapeno, and cilantro.
